Hi,
There are VBA tricks using Events and Dynamic Named Ranges and Advanced Filters to hide all the OR functionality in your problem. BUT - to use them correctly leads to more problems than I think they solve. If you teach those end users how to use Advanced Filters it will be transferable knowledge to other tables and problems using Excel.
NOW - if you were to attach a sample file with the data design as you have it and how you want it to look, we could do a much better job in trying to answer your question.
To attach a file click on "Go Advanced" below the message area and then on the Paper Clip Icon above the advanced message area.
Bookmarks